OK - one for you digital creatives out there. I'm either looking for the info I need here, or a link to somewhere I might be able to find it:
I am looking for a reasonably priced (not dirt cheap and nasty) printer that has the following features:
Mono Laser Printer
Straight through Paper Path
Must be able to print onto Card up to 300GSM
Duplex Printing
I've been trying to find one but the sticking point appears to be the card weight. If anyone on here is in the know, that would be fantastic!
Thank you.

duplex is difficult if not impossible on a straight through print, as the machine needs to flip the paper over to print both sides, this is normally done by rollers within the machine. On my laser you have to flip the paper manually and feed it back through, it doesn't do a straight through print though.0
-
I've seen Lasers that have a standard wrap-around path with duplex plus a tray for straight through printing; where I'm having trouble is finding one that reliably print onto card.0
